Context:
Nadeau, Michigan, located in the Upper Peninsula, is a small town with a population of around 1,200. It is known for its beautiful forests, lakes, and outdoor recreational activities like fishing and hunting. The nearest major city is Green Bay, Wisconsin, which is about an hour and a half drive away. With its rural setting and close-knit community, Nadeau may be an appealing option for those looking for a quieter lifestyle.
